Runbook 4.2 — AgriLink telemetry gateway account recovery. If the Harrowfield gateway loses its operator binding after a firmware rollback, do not re-flash. Instead, boot into maintenance mode, verify the device serial against the fleet ledger, and select "Restore operator account." The console will then ask for the standing recovery credential. Enter the passphrase that appears directly below this paragraph.

unlock words, kawig-bawef: belax-sorir-druax-ulaiel-wenael-belael

## Checkout Load Test — Pomford Storefront

Before each peak season, we replay synthetic carts through the Pomford checkout staging stack using the Lanternmill harness. Support should expect elevated alert noise during the run window. If a customer reports failures mid-test, tag the ticket with the run ID. The harness authenticates to staging with the key below.

API key for yahig-tadup: kto7_ubizbYm

## GarageGlance Occupancy Feed — Env Vars

Quick notes before the weekly sync: the occupancy feed for the Larkmoor Deck garages now polls every 30 seconds instead of 60, so watch the rate counters. Config lives in the usual `.env` for the `stall-counter` service. `GLANCE_POLL_INTERVAL` and `GLANCE_REGION` are unchanged. The only new requirement is the feed token from the Veldt Parking portal — rotate it quarterly, please. Drop it into your local env file exactly as shown on the next line.

env line for fafof-fahag: LEDGER_TOKEN5=f8790